 Pursuit Force PSP This Spring, Sony Computer Entertainment America introduces Pursuit Force, an all-new original arcade-action title developed by BigBig Studios, Ltd. exclusively for the PSP (PlayStationPortable) system. In Pursuit Force, players take the role of a rookie police officer responsible for tracking down and bringing to justice five criminal gangs in and around Capital City. As a member of a special police unit known as the Pursuit Force, players will engage in high-speed action to traverse land, air, and sea in a war to rid the city of crime. Featuring 30 criminal cases set among five distinct environments, players will have access to 55 different vehicles and up to 25 types of weapons in the pursuit of justice. With the goal of taking the gangs down by any means necessary, players will be able to maintain constant pursuit by jumping from one moving vehicle to another as well as fight and dodge enemies while hanging on at breakneck speeds. Throughout the various criminal cases, players will engage in adrenaline pumping action in vehicles, on-foot, and by air. A variety of unique gameplay elements come together as you struggle to stop the gang threat and bring peace back to the state. KEY FEATURES Jump between moving vehicles on land, sea, and air to overtake an enemy. Fight on vehicles, dodge enemy fire, and hang on while traveling at speeds of over 150 MPH. More than 10 hours of diverse gameplay including vehicle chases, on-foot action, and flying missions where players must operate a helicopter mini-gun. 55 vehicles available throughout the game including cars, SUVs, trucks, buses, bikes, and speed boats. More than 10 types of weapons at the player's disposal including handguns, shotguns, machine guns, and some heavy artillery.
 Need for Speed:Hot Pursuit 2 PS2 Need For Speed: Hot Pursuit 2 is an action-packed racing game that enables players to take the wheel of one of 22 of the world's finest, fastest cars and drive them flat out in a series of street races. Standing between you and a podium place are a variety of other drivers, and the Highway Patrol, who do not take kindly to people driving around their streets like lunatics, and will try to stop you at all costs. Part racing game, part high speed crash-and-bash chase, and all fun, Need for Speed: Hot Pursuit 2 is a game that's highly recommended to drivers who like their racing games to be larger than life. Features: 12 courses featuring seaside vistas, burning forests, sparkling waterfalls and dusty paths bring new challenges to all you leadfoots Weather effects from rain to snow make driving even more exciting Each level contains up to 5 unique shortcuts that you can use to either place ahead of your fellow racers or use to escape a heavy ticket A wide variety of different play modes add extra lasting appeal. Play as a racer and become the best driver, or take the role of a traffic cop and bash speeders off the road.

Unlike many such adaptations, the game closely follows the plot and scenery of the movie. Action game - Action games could be considered the video game equivalent of action movies. Action games typically feature violent physical force, especially shooting, as their main interactive feature. Action-adventure game - Action-adventure games are video games that combine elements of the adventure game genre with various action elements. Nintendo is generally cited as originating the genre with The Legend of Zelda (1986); as a result, action-adventure games are simply called "adventure games" by many console gamers.
